Alan's Story

Hi! I’m Alan and I’m named after Alan Shepard – the first American in space! While I may not make it into space, I am sure going to make my way into your heart. I have a beautiful black snout that is soft like velvet, which leads directly to my stunning green eyes. My expressions will let you know exactly how I am feeling, which is usually just pure love. I love playing with toys and carrying them around trying to hide them from my siblings. My second favorite thing to do is to be cuddled and loved on. My foster parents say I am so smart because the majority of the time, I pee on the pee pads! See, I’m intelligent just like the astronaut I’m named after.
